Нижегородский файловый портал
RSS - каналы
Главное меню
Категории каталога
Мои статьи [5]
Школа покера [5]
Софт [40]
Радиолюбителям и электрикам [8]
Интернет [167]
Система [89]
Комплектующие ПК [47]
Безопасность [56]
Программирование [18]
Веб-дизайнеру [5]
Игры [6]
Полезные советы [24]
Кулинария [1]
Телефония [10]
Мобильник [17]
Планшеты [14]
Медицина [5]
Работа [4]
Домашнему мастеру [0]
Строительство и ремонт [19]
Для сада и огорода [2]
Юмор и приколы [12]
Интересное [114]
Пластики [3]
Разное [238]
Мини-чат
Правила мини-чата



Мини-чат в окне
Погода в Нижнем
Яндекс.Погода
Главная » Статьи » Система

Не хватает DLL'ки... Что делать?
Наверняка каждый из Вас хоть раз в жизни сталкивался с невозможностью запустить ту или иную программу по причине отсутствия необходимых динамических библиотек, в просторечье называемых DLL'ками. В большинстве случаев проблема решаема, и довольно просто.

Итак, предположим, Вы запустили программу, а она Вам в ответ выдала сообщение "Приложению не удалось запуститься, поскольку SuperPuperCool.dll не был найден. Повторная установка приложения может исправить эту проблему".

Казалось бы, чего тут думать - система сама же и предлагает не самый кровавый вариант решения этой проблемы, нужно вот только вспомнить, где же лежал дистрибутив этой программы. Нет, система-то, конечно, тысячу раз права, если, конечно, не хватает не какой-нибудь из системных библиотек.


Однако способ может не сработать - это раз. Многие разработчики элементарно забывают добавить в дистрибутив своей программы пару-тройку библиотек, которые написали не они, но которые, тем не менее, используются в их программном продукте. И тогда можно хоть сто раз переустанавливать программу - необходимых библиотек от этого больше ну никак не станет.

Второй минус данного способа заключается в том, что нужен дистрибутив программы. Хорошо, если он есть у Вас под рукой, а если нет? Большие дистрибутивы и скачивать накладно, и процесс установки более-менее крупных программ тоже вещь не быстрая.


В общем-то, из всего этого вытекает, что имеет смысл ещё до переустановки попробовать какой-нибудь альтернативный способ решения проблемы, а вот уж если он не "прокатит", тогда и отправляться на поиски дистрибутива нужной программы.

Способ, который я сейчас Вам хочу предложить, до смешного банален. Заключается он в том, чтобы поискать нужную Вам DLL-библиотеку в интернете. Да, конечно, для этого нужен доступ к Всемирной сети, однако и для скачивания дистрибутивов программ он тоже, скажем так, не помешает. Однако, как я уже говорил, скачать отдельный DLL-файл может оказаться гораздо проще, чем целый дистрибутив.

Искать DLL-файлы можно, конечно, с помощью Google, "Яндекса", "Рамблера" и прочих обычных поисковиков. Но гораздо проще воспользоваться специализированными архивами DLL-файлов, которых на бескрайних просторах Интернета появилось немало.

Лично мне больше всего нравятся три следующих: www.dll-files.com, www.dll.ru и www.dlldll.ru. В Байнете пока подобных сайтов не появилось, но, может быть, когда-нибудь и отечественные пользователи на такое решатся. Хотя сейчас вполне достаточно и существующих архивов.


Хотя все сайты предлагают алфавитные списки разных DLL-файлов, гораздо проще будет ввести имя нужной библиотеки в строку поиска, которая есть на главной странице. Но при выборе нужной библиотеки среди результатов поиска нужно быть внимательным: названия некоторых библиотек могут совпадать для разных программ, и нужно следить за тем, чтобы скачивалась DLL'ка именно для той программы, которая у Вас не хочет запускаться.

Что касается версий библиотек, то совсем не обязательно она должна совпадать с версией самой программы. Так что при прочих равных лучше скачивать самую новую - довольно высока вероятность того, что программа, нуждающаяся в более старой версии, будет работать и с этой. Только если версия библиотеки указана в самом её имени (например, msvbvm50.dll), не надо скачивать библиотеку с другим именем и более новой версией (например, msvbvm60.dll).


Если библиотека не нашлась на одном архиве, попробуйте поискать на другом, третьем, подключите Google - в общем, подойдите к её поиску творчески. Ну, а если найти DLL'ку не удастся или программа не захочет с ней работать, - что ж, значит, придётся переустановить эту программу.

Добавил: Админ-21NN | Просмотров: 3997 | Рейтинг: 5.0/2


Обратите Ваше внимание на другие статьи:

Уважаемые пользователи, пожалуйста, оставляйте комментарии! Нам очень важно Ваше мнение!
Всего комментариев: 0
Добавлять комментарии могут только зарегистрированные пользователи.

    
Меню пользователя
Аватар гостя

Приветствуем Вас, Гость

Логин:
Пароль:
Поиск по сайту
Поиск по названию
Поиск по тегам
Горячие темы форума
Стол заказов
поговорим о софте
Зарабатываем деньги
Детская игра Подарки...
Тест скорости подклю...
кое что о Windows
Кто ты, человек?
Новая валюта портала
Все о сексе
"Что мешает нам...
Культура
Афоризмы
Лучшие 13 анекдотов ...
как защитить свой ко...
восстановление данны...
Я ненавижу Дом-2
Волга-Телеком
Кулинария "Кокт...
Жалобы
С Днем Победы!!!
Прикольные картинки
С праздником Пасхи !...
Статистика
Новых за месяц: 130
Новых за неделю: 41
Новых вчера: 6
Новых сегодня: 3
Всего: 5499
Из них:
Администраторов: 6
$$$-Модераторов: 2
Модераторов: 5
Прокураторов: 5
-----------------
далее:
Проверенных: 260
Пользователей: 3034
Новичков: 1884
Заблокированных: 110
-----------------
Из всех пользователей:
Мужчин и парней: 4322
Женщин и девушек: 1176
Именинники
Поздравляем с Днем рожденья:

romka(31), dolzr(53), ransioojne(86), Kostik(32), Sovenok(32), Ufozver(24), ethan21(26), cavaleron(26), Аревка(38), zdvfzasxdv(24), Quantum0(23)
Режим ON-LINE
Онлайн всего: 1
Гостей: 1
Пользователей: 0

Сейчас на портале:
Наша кнопочка
Нижегородский файловый портал

HTML-код кнопки:
Реклама
Размещение рекламы

Яндекс.Метрика
Регистрация сайта в каталогах, раскрутка и оптимизация сайта, контекстная реклама Ремонт холодильников в Нижнем Новгороде

Copyright © BankRemStroy © 2009-2019
x